1. Targeting Your Waist: Defining the Midsection

The waist is often a key area for women looking to define their curves or create an hourglass silhouette. Whether you have a naturally defined waist or you want to create one, here’s how to target this area with your clothing choices:

1.1. Belts and Waistbands

A simple way to emphasize your waist is with a belt or a high-waisted waistband. These accessories not only accentuate your natural curves but also create the illusion of a smaller waist.

  • Outfit Idea: Pair a high-waisted skirt or pants with a belted jacket or peplum top to draw attention to your midsection. Opt for wide belts for a bold statement or thin belts for a more delicate look.

1.2. Tailored and Fitted Styles

Tailored dresses or fitted tops that cinch at the waist will naturally highlight this area. Look for pieces that create structure and shape, such as A-line dresses or fitted blazers.

  • Outfit Idea: A fitted blazer over a slim-fit dress will create a sharp, hourglass shape, while A-line skirts or high-waisted trousers will elongate the legs and emphasize your waist.

1.3. Peplum and Wrap Styles

Peplum tops or wrap dresses are excellent choices for creating the appearance of a defined waist. These styles add volume at the hips and give the illusion of a more pronounced waistline.

  • Outfit Idea: A peplum top paired with skinny jeans or a wrap dress will enhance your waist and create a balanced, feminine shape.

2. Highlighting Your Legs: Making Your Lower Half Stand Out

If you’re proud of your legs and want to show them off, there are plenty of ways to dress to draw attention to this feature.

2.1. Skirts and Dresses

Short skirts and mini dresses naturally highlight your legs. Go for skirts that are above the knee to give your legs a longer, leaner appearance.

  • Outfit Idea: A mini skirt paired with tights and ankle boots creates a sharp, stylish look. Alternatively, a short dress with a V-neckline or high-low hem will draw attention downward and elongate your legs.

2.2. High-Waisted Bottoms

High-waisted pants or skirts not only help define your waist but also elongate the legs, making them appear longer and leaner.

  • Outfit Idea: Pair high-waisted trousers with a crop top or tucked-in blouse to draw attention to your legs. High-waisted jeans with a fitted top will create a balanced look and give your legs a boost in length.

2.3. Pointed Shoes

Pointed-toe shoes are another great way to make your legs look longer. The sharp tip of the shoe elongates the appearance of your feet and legs, giving you a leaner silhouette.

  • Outfit Idea: Pair pointed-toe heels or flats with any outfit—whether it’s skinny jeans or a mini dress—to create a streamlined, leg-lengthening effect.

3. Drawing Attention to Your Shoulders: Creating an Upside-Down Triangle

For those looking to highlight their shoulders and create a balanced, proportioned look, focus on creating an upside-down triangle with your outfits.

3.1. Off-the-Shoulder or Strapless Tops

Off-the-shoulder or strapless tops draw attention to your shoulders and collarbones, creating a feminine, elegant look.

  • Outfit Idea: Pair an off-the-shoulder top with high-waisted trousers or a pencil skirt to accentuate your upper body while keeping the look chic and balanced.

3.2. Puff Sleeves or Structured Shoulders

Adding volume to the shoulders with puff sleeves or structured blazers helps to create the appearance of broader shoulders and can balance out your proportions.

  • Outfit Idea: Opt for a puffed sleeve blouse or a structured shoulder blazer worn over fitted pants or a slim skirt for an empowered, modern look.

3.3. V-Necklines

A V-neckline naturally draws the eye upwards and emphasizes the shoulders while elongating the neck, which adds elegance to the overall outfit.

  • Outfit Idea: A V-neck dress or top will flatter your upper body by drawing attention to your shoulders and creating a more defined silhouette.

4. Creating the Illusion of Height: Dressing for a Taller Silhouette

If you’re looking to appear taller or elongate your figure, there are simple tricks you can use to create the illusion of height.

4.1. Vertical Stripes

Vertical stripes naturally elongate the body and make you appear taller. This pattern can be incorporated into everything from shirts and dresses to pants and skirts.

  • Outfit Idea: A striped midi dress or vertical-striped trousers paired with a fitted blouse creates a long, lean silhouette that elongates your body.

4.2. Monochrome Outfits

Wearing a monochrome outfit—where all pieces are the same color—creates a seamless, uninterrupted line from head to toe, which can make you appear taller.

  • Outfit Idea: A black jumpsuit or a navy ensemble with a matching blazer gives the illusion of a longer torso and legs.

4.3. Heels or Platforms

High-heeled shoes or platforms can instantly add height to your look. Look for shoes with a pointed toe to elongate your legs further.

  • Outfit Idea: Pair a sleek jumpsuit or tailored pants with heeled boots or stiletto heels to add instant height and create a polished appearance.

5. Drawing Focus to Your Face: Creating a Balanced Top Half

If you want to draw attention to your face, headwear and accessories are great tools to focus the eye upward.

5.1. Statement Necklaces or Earrings

A bold necklace or statement earrings can pull attention to your face and add visual interest to your outfit. Opt for pieces that frame the face or hang at an ideal length to draw the eye upward.

  • Outfit Idea: Pair a statement necklace with a high-neck blouse or turtleneck for a chic, polished look. For earrings, dangly or oversized earrings work wonders with simple, understated outfits.

5.2. Hairstyles

Your hairstyle can also play a big part in drawing focus to your face. Soft waves, voluminous updos, or a well-placed fringe can all help accentuate your features.

  • Outfit Idea: A classic bun or loose waves paired with a bold lip color and minimal makeup will keep your look fresh while letting your face shine.

5.3. High Collars or Turtlenecks

A high collar or turtleneck subtly frames your face, drawing attention to it while keeping the look sophisticated.

  • Outfit Idea: A turtleneck sweater paired with tailored pants or a pencil skirt creates a clean, sharp look that focuses attention on the face.
